Junwen Xu is a scholar working on Materials Chemistry, Molecular Biology and Inorganic Chemistry. According to data from OpenAlex, Junwen Xu has authored 20 papers receiving a total of 354 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Materials Chemistry, 6 papers in Molecular Biology and 5 papers in Inorganic Chemistry. Recurrent topics in Junwen Xu’s work include Covalent Organic Framework Applications (5 papers), Metal-Organic Frameworks: Synthesis and Applications (4 papers) and MicroRNA in disease regulation (3 papers). Junwen Xu is often cited by papers focused on Covalent Organic Framework Applications (5 papers), Metal-Organic Frameworks: Synthesis and Applications (4 papers) and MicroRNA in disease regulation (3 papers). Junwen Xu collaborates with scholars based in China. Junwen Xu's co-authors include Jincui Gu, Yanbin Zhou, Junjie Ou, Jinlun Feng, Shaoli Li, Lixia Huang, Yefei Zhu, Shujuan Ma, Jian Wu and Weijun Ou and has published in prestigious journals such as Analytical Chemistry, ACS Applied Materials & Interfaces and Analytica Chimica Acta.
